为了账号安全,请及时绑定邮箱和手机立即绑定

如果字符串的长度更大,如何添加空格

如果字符串的长度更大,如何添加空格

拉丁的传说 2021-06-03 17:39:26
string如果String值大于 22,我只需要将大小设置为22 我需要从第 23 个字母开始显示 10 个空字符(空格)。这个小逻辑怎么做?if (name.length()>22)        {            StringBuilder stringBuilder = new StringBuilder();            stringBuilder.append(name+"%+23s");        }这个逻辑正确吗?
查看完整描述

3 回答

?
拉风的咖菲猫

TA贡献1995条经验 获得超2个赞

你可以使用setLength


StringBuilder stringBuilder = new StringBuilder();

..

..

if (stringBuilder.length () > 22)

{

   stringBuilder.setLength(22);

   stringBuilder.append(" ");// append number of space characters here

}


查看完整回答
反对 回复 2021-06-10
  • 3 回答
  • 0 关注
  • 124 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信